Rs 100 million sequel to My Friend Ganesha

MUMBAI: Even before the release of the animation movie My Friend Ganesha, the film’s makers – Koffee Break Productions – have planned a sequel to it. Titled Ganesha Rocks New York the film is scheduled to go on floors in New York by July end or early August this year.


Confirming the same to Businessofcinema.com, Koffee Break Productions managing director Apoorva Shah says, “Yes we are planning a sequel to My Friend Ganesha. Currently the scripting and casting is underway. Ahsaas Channa will definitely be part of the film, we are still looking at finalizing the remaining cast.”


While My Friend Ganesha, a live character animation movie has been made on a budget of Rs 40 million (Rs 4 crore), the scale of Ganesha Rocks New York will be bigger. “It will be made on a budget of Rs 100 million (Rs 10 crore) and the quality will be 10 times better. Also the character of Ganesha will undergo some changes in terms of look and costume to suit the New York setting.”


The animation for Ganesha Rocks New York will continue to be worked upon at Radiant Animation, which also worked on My Friend Ganesha.


“The response towards Ganesha’s character has been stupendous and we are confident that people will like the product in the future as well,” Shah concludes.


My Friend Ganesha hits theatres across India this Friday – 6 July, 2007.
